SSR Fans trend #boycottbingo and bash Ranveer Singh for the product's ad

Bingo ad faces backlash as SSR fans found resemblance to his behaviour in the character played by Ranveer Singh.


The latest target of netizens' anger is popular Bingo chips and its brand ambassador Bollywood actor Ranveer Singh, both of whom are accused of making fun of the late actor Sushant Singh Rajput for their recent collaboration with the ad 'Beta aage kya plan hai'.

The controversial ad depicts Ranveer Singh attending a house party when an adult asks him about his plans for the future. Soon, several uncles and aunts start suggesting options while Ranveer, after having a Bingo chip, mentioned some scientific terms such as 'photon', 'algorithm' and 'paradox' to close relatives. As soon as the confused relatives leave, Ranveer reveals that the only solution to these tricky questions is to use the ‘mad angle’.

After the ad was released and the audience saw it, social media users were annoyed to see how words like 'photon', 'algorithm' and 'paradox' were included in the script allegedly to taking a jibe at late actor Sushant Singh Rajput, who loved to talk about science, astronomy and was interested in the study of space. In fact, Sushant's Instagram bio reads, "Photon in a double-slit". The late actor also used to mention algorithms and space on his social media posts.

As a result, the ad led Twitterati to believe that Ranveer is making fun of Sushant and therefore wanted the ad to be banned and started the  #BoycottBingo campaign to vent their anger over the ad.
